I know to convert an ecsb you would extend the frame 13 inches and move the body mounts. I also second that a ccsb would look better

When i did my back half Mr. Max Fish recommended I use 2x4" .120 wall on a fullsize. He said 2x3 would be too small and using 3/16 would add unneeded weight. Just a little FYI. I want to turn my ext cab into a crew cab short bed as well!:cool:
